Viewtiful Joe (video game)

Viewtiful Joe is a cel-shaded side-scrolling beat 'em up video game developed by Clover Studio and published by Capcom. It was originally released for the GameCube in 2003 and later ported to the PlayStation 2 in 2004.

The game centers around Joe, an avid movie enthusiast who is transported into Movieland by his favorite action hero, Captain Blue. When Movieland is invaded by evil forces, Captain Blue bestows upon Joe the V-Watch, which grants him the power to transform into Viewtiful Joe, a tokusatsu-inspired superhero.

As Viewtiful Joe, players navigate various stages, battling enemies and solving puzzles using special VFX powers: Slow, Mach Speed, and Zoom. These powers manipulate time and perspective, allowing Joe to overcome obstacles and defeat enemies in creative ways. Slow slows down time, allowing Joe to dodge attacks and deal extra damage. Mach Speed allows Joe to perform rapid punches and kicks, leaving behind afterimages. Zoom allows Joe to zoom in and perform a powerful attack, like a heat wave-inducing punch or a lightning strike.

The game features a distinctive visual style characterized by its cel-shaded graphics, dynamic camera angles, and over-the-top action sequences. The gameplay emphasizes skill-based combat and encourages experimentation with the VFX powers to discover new strategies.

Viewtiful Joe received critical acclaim for its innovative gameplay mechanics, unique visual style, and challenging difficulty. It spawned several sequels and spin-offs, including Viewtiful Joe 2, Viewtiful Joe: Red Hot Rumble, and Viewtiful Joe: Double Trouble!. It is considered a cult classic and a notable example of Clover Studio's distinctive game development philosophy.
